| What is Ice Planet? |
| Ice planet is a new science fiction drama series planned to be aired in October 2006. There will also be a tightly integrated game to accompany the TV show. Below are the two most significant press releases describing the show in some detail; the first is the announcement from SciFi Uk, and the second from Spaceworks, who will do do the production. |

| Synopsis |
| Rear Admiral Noah Trager (Michael Ironside) leads an international team of
military and scientific personnel in the recovery of an ancient alien artifact. This
sentient alien structure seems to draw on the memories of its human explorers
as it grows.
Trager, who dotes on his 10-year-old daughter, must also contend with another
mystery in his life --the unsolved murder of his wife. This is his obsession.
As they explore the Artifact, Earth is devastated by a massive asteroid strike. At
that very moment, the Artifact rips Trager and his crew through space-time to
a mysterious Ice Planet at the edge of an ancient galaxy. Their only shelter is
the damaged alien vessel. The survivors soon discover they have been dropped into the midst of an
ancient alien war. They must now face a journey of evolution and self-discovery
in order to fulfill their destinies. The battle often plays out as personal challenges that originate from the pasts
of the survivors themselves. Cyphers of the dead will haunt our crew, such as
the replicant of Trager’s daughter – through which the aliens communicate. It
cannot be her, but she seems real, and a force of great danger and great hope. These are the survivors’ stories. |

| Format information |
| Ice Planet is a HD TV series -22 X 60 episodes. Available 2007. Michael Ironside leads an ensemble cast in this five-season
story arc which is being shot with the revolutionary new HD
camera, the Viper FilmStream. Ice Planet, next to Spielberg’s
The 4400, will be one of the first science fiction television series
using this dazzling technology. Directing the photography is Emmy-Award nominee Michael
McMurray and heading the script department is Emmy-Award
winner Anna Bourque. Harley Cokeliss (director of pilot
episodes of Xena Princess Warrior and Hercules), International Emmy nominee, is directing the first episodes. And to bridge the ever-widening gap between television and
gaming audiences, Ice Planet will roll out a mobile game
day-and-date with the premiere of the TV series and a console
game at the season’s finale. From the producers of Starhunter, Ice Planet promises to be a
science fiction entertainment experience unlike anything seen before. |
